Technological Innovations

Energy-Efficient Consensus Mechanisms

One of the most significant technological advancements in ethical cryptocurrencies is the development of energy-efficient consensus mechanisms. Traditional proof-of-work (PoW) systems, like those used by Bitcoin, consume vast amounts of energy. To address this, alternative consensus mechanisms like proof-of-stake (PoS) and delegated proof-of-stake (DPoS) have emerged.

PoS systems require validators to hold a certain amount of cryptocurrency tokens to participate in the consensus process. This method significantly reduces energy consumption compared to PoW, as it doesn't require intensive mining operations. Projects like Cardano and Tezos have adopted PoS, demonstrating a commitment to environmental sustainability.

Enhanced Security

Security remains a paramount concern for both buyers and sellers in the e-commerce landscape. With traditional methods, there's always a risk of data breaches and fraudulent activities. AI payment gateways bolster security through advanced encryption, real-time monitoring, and predictive analytics. They can identify and flag suspicious activities with pinpoint accuracy, often before the user even notices something amiss.

For example, AI can analyze transaction patterns to determine what constitutes normal behavior for a particular user. If an atypical transaction occurs, the system flags it for review, often preventing fraud before it happens. This proactive approach to security not only protects consumer data but also builds trust in the e-commerce platform.

Fraud Prevention

Fraud is an ever-present threat in the digital world, and no business wants to be on the wrong end of a fraudulent transaction. AI payment gateways bring sophisticated fraud detection mechanisms to the table. They employ various techniques like anomaly detection, which identifies unusual patterns that deviate from established norms.

Consider a situation where an account is used from a different geographical location than usual. AI can flag this as potentially fraudulent and require additional verification before proceeding. This level of scrutiny significantly reduces the chances of fraudulent activities going unnoticed.
